Output 51fc943006ebff8a5cac6c940c3c19feb10ae3a56ce8628335084e323c8018f9:1

value
11695847
script pubkey
OP_0 OP_PUSHBYTES_20 5d5dc9cc2e52514d232a0994ab196bdc43141a86
address
ltc1qt4wunnpw2fg56ge2px22kxttm3p3gx5xnx3ha6
transaction
51fc943006ebff8a5cac6c940c3c19feb10ae3a56ce8628335084e323c8018f9
spent
true